Xender is an application that connects two or more smartphones to share photos, applications, and other media. It was founded by Xender Team (originally known as Anmobi.inc). Xender is available on four operating systems (Android, iOS, Windows Phone, Tizen) and in 22 languages. The application was originally released in China with the name Shan Chuan in 2012 and was known as Flash Transfer outside China. In 2013, it supported more languages and its name was changed to Xender.
